About Turkey bacon egg sandwich

The Turkey Bacon Egg Sandwich is a savory breakfast option that combines lean protein and flavorful ingredients for a satisfying start to the day. This sandwich typically features turkey bacon, scrambled or fried eggs, and your choice of cheese layered on a whole-grain bun, English muffin, or toast. Originating from American cuisine, it has become a popular alternative to traditional bacon and egg sandwiches, offering a lighter twist. Turkey bacon is lower in fat and calories compared to pork bacon, making this sandwich a healthier substitute. Eggs provide essential nutrients like protein and choline, while the whole-grain base adds fiber for sustained energy. However, depending on your choice of cheese or bread, sodium and saturated fat levels may vary. Pairing it with fresh vegetables or avocado can further boost its nutritional profile, making it a wholesome and balanced meal option.
